    San Diego Comic-Con 2014 (July 24th-27th)

    It's that time again for news on SDCC. I'll update this as much as possible:

    New Pricing and Ticket Changes:

    The prices have increased $3-6 depending on the day over last year:




    This year instead of the 4-Day pass, you will have to buy the days individually. They will combine the individual days into a 4-Day pass on site. Individuals are eligible to purchase preview night only if they buy all 4 days.

    Able to share information about policy changes to Hall H since it was released today. Hall H is switching over to a wristband system:

    Basically if you don't know, Hall H is where all the big movie studios have their panels on Saturday (Big TV shows on Sunday such as Supernatural and Doctor Who though Doctor who will not be present this year). The exhibition hall seats 6500 people and attendees tend to line up outside Hall H the night before and camp out. This lead to long lines and people would often get in line at the back and not get in. Now CCI is issuing color coded wristbands that tell you exactly your place in line. There will be four colors that represent 1/4 of the capacity. So for instance the first 1625 people in line get a red wristband, then the next 1625 get Yellow, then Green, then Blue. This is helpful because if you were to go stand in line and you saw that blue wristbands stop at 100 people ahead of you, then you know you are not getting into the first panel and you will have to wait for 100 people to leave for you to get into the next panel. This effects the line buddy system (people who stand in line in shifts) because all members of your group need to be present at the 1am wristband handout.

    As much as this is a good idea and has been mentioned so many times, I can tell you they will not do it for several reasons. Some of the big studios do not like the idea of streaming the panels even if paid because it is an exclusive affair and they want to keep it that way. Also for some who go, Hall H is legendary and it is a big pull to actually go and personally be there instead of watching a stream. Though you can end up in the back looking at big screens it almost is the same thing, but at the same time it's not. Hell, two years ago during the Marvel Panel, Robert Downy Jr surprised the crowd and came out to Luther Vandross "Never Too Much" while swag walking down the isle giving fans high fives wearing the hand armor from the Iron Man suit. It just wouldn't feel the same watching that through a computer/tv.

    One of the best ideas I always hear is for them to do panels across the street a PetCo Park since it can hold a little less than 1/3rd of comic con attendees (roughly 130,000 go each year) but the cost would be astronomical apparently

    As far as the wristbands go, I think it is a step in the right direction, albeit a small one, but things will get a little better after the expansion when Hall H will expand to hold somewhere close to 10,000 people.
